Kunal Banerjee is a scholar working on Computational Theory and Mathematics, Artificial Intelligence and Hardware and Architecture. According to data from OpenAlex, Kunal Banerjee has authored 21 papers receiving a total of 190 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Computational Theory and Mathematics, 6 papers in Artificial Intelligence and 6 papers in Hardware and Architecture. Recurrent topics in Kunal Banerjee’s work include Formal Methods in Verification (7 papers), Software Testing and Debugging Techniques (5 papers) and Parallel Computing and Optimization Techniques (4 papers). Kunal Banerjee is often cited by papers focused on Formal Methods in Verification (7 papers), Software Testing and Debugging Techniques (5 papers) and Parallel Computing and Optimization Techniques (4 papers). Kunal Banerjee collaborates with scholars based in India, United Kingdom and Switzerland. Kunal Banerjee's co-authors include Y. S. Mayya, Bijay Kumar Sahoo, B.K. Sapra, J.J. Gaware, H.S. Kushwaha, Chittaranjan Mandal, Dipankar Sarkar, C.J. van Westen, Chandan Karfa and Rishi Gupta and has published in prestigious journals such as Information Sciences, IEEE Transactions on Software Engineering and Environmental Earth Sciences.
